   KEITHLEY 2520   Description / Specification:    
KEITHLEY 2520 Pulsed Laser Diode Test System

The Keithley 2520 Pulsed Laser Diode Test System is an integrated, synchronized system for testing laser diodes early in the manufacturing process, when proper temperature control cannot be easily achieved. The Model 2520 provides all sourcing and measurement capabilities needed for pulsed and continuous LIV (light-current-voltage) testing of laser diodes in one compact, half-rack instrument. The tight synchronization of source and measure capabilities ensures high measurement accuracy, even when testing with pulse widths as short as 500ns. Specifications: Pulse Laser Diode Test System w/ Remote Test Head: Integrated solution for in-process LIV production testing of laser diodes at the chip or bar level. Sweep can be programmed to stop on optical power limit. Programmable pulse on time from 500ns to 5ms up to 4% duty cycle. Pulse capability up to 5A, DC capability up to 1A. 14-bit measurement accuracy on three measurement channels (VF, front photodiode, back photodiode). Measurement algorithm increases the pulse measurement's signal-to-noise ratio. Up to 1000-point sweep stored in buffer memory eliminates GPIB traffic during test, increasing throughout. Digital I/O binning and handling operations IEEE-488 and RS-232 interfaces.

Amplified Spontaneous Emission Source (ASE)
ASE, a process where spontaneously emitted radiation (luminescence) is amplified. In lasers and particularly in high-gain erbium-doped amplifiers, amplified spontaneous emission is usually an unwanted effect. It tends to limit the gain achievable in a single stage of a fiber optic amplifier to the order of 40–50 dB.

Dynamic Range
In a transmission system, the ratio of the overload level to the noise level of the system, usually expressed in dB. Ratio of the highest to lowest detectable signal of a system, expressed in dB.

Optical Power
Optical Power is usually measured in "dBm", or decibels referenced to one miliwatt of power. while loss is a relative reading, optical power is an absolute measurement, referenced to standards. You measure absolute power to test transmitters or receivers and relative power to test loss.

Relative Wavelength Accuracy
When randomly changing the wavelength and measuring the differences between the actual and displayed wavelengths, the relative wavelength accuracy is ± half the span between the maximum and the minimum value of all differences.

Wavelength
Wavelength is a term for the color of light, usually expressed in nanometers (nm) or microns (m). In Fiber Optics the wavelenghts mostly used are in the infrared region where the light is invisible to the human eye.
